from numpy import float64, int64
import pytest
from pygeoapi.provider.xarray_ import XarrayProvider
from pygeoapi.util import json_serial
from .util import get_test_file_path
path = get_test_file_path(
'data/analysed_sst.zarr')
@pytest.fixture()
def config():
return {
'name': 'zarr',
'type': 'coverage',
'data': path,
'format': {
'name': 'zarr',
'mimetype': 'application/zip'
}
}
def test_provider(config):
p = XarrayProvider(config)
assert len(p.fields) == 4
assert len(p.axes) == 3
assert p.axes == ['lon', 'lat', 'time']
def test_schema(config):
p = XarrayProvider(config)
assert isinstance(p.fields, dict)
assert len(p.fields) == 4
assert p.fields['analysed_sst']['title'] == 'analysed sea surface temperature' # noqa
def test_query(config):
p = XarrayProvider(config)
data = p.query()
assert isinstance(data, dict)
data = p.query(format_='zarr')
assert isinstance(data, bytes)
def test_numpy_json_serial():
d = int64(500_000_000_000)
assert json_serial(d) == 500_000_000_000
d = float64(500.00000005)
assert json_serial(d) == 500.00000005
